interesting...humm..the illustration is a well know image. It is the Currier & Ives work entitled "The American National Game of Baseball"...google the american national game of baseball and you will see many versions.

"The most famous, and the most sought-after baseball print, is the Currier & Ives print "The American National Game of Baseball. The Grand Match for the Championship at the Elysian Fields, Hoboken, N.J." Issued in 1866 shortly after the Civil War, this is a terrific, large folio print showing a championship game in 1865, between the Mutual Club of Manhattan and the Atlantic Club of Brooklyn. "

The Currier Ives lithograph is described as 1865 game, yet your Walden illustration says 1858.
